He told Cook it was original paint. I believe some aspects of it are, like the cowl, but the car in general has been painted.
He's wrong about his reasoning as to why he believes the hood was added. It very well could have been equipped with it. 01B car, the hood was in production a couple weeks prior. Would need to look at the car closer. However, with that said, majority of Z's were in fact flat hood cars anyway.
I'm not buying his explanation for the stripe either. The car is too early to have a wide spoiler, it's been added. It's also missing the support bars on the front chin spoiler that so many people never add when putting spoilers on. I'm betting it has standard torsion rods in the trunk. Dealer added.....maybe, but the stripes weren't done that way at the factory on a "real" spoiler car.
